Welcome to Delagyle Lodge & Fishings

Your escape to the tranquillity of the Middle Spey.

Nestled amidst the serene splendor of Aberlour, Scotland, Delagyle Lodge & Fishings stands as a beacon of relaxation and unparalleled natural beauty on the banks of the iconic River Spey. As you step through our doors, you embark on a journey to a realm where the whispers of the river intertwine with the whispers of history, offering a sanctuary away from the hustle and bustle of daily life.

Explore our lodge